MOT reliability
Honda Mrt 250-c
31 vehicles · 38 completed MOT tests analysed
92%
MOT pass rate
Based on 31 Honda Mrt 250-c vehicles and 38 completed MOT tests, the Honda Mrt 250-c has an overall 92% pass rate, with an average recorded mileage of 840 miles.

Most common Honda Mrt 250-c MOT faults
These are the faults and advisories recorded most often across Honda Mrt 250-c MOT tests:
- No lights fitted at time of test (4 times)
- this vehicle is for day light use only (3 times)
- only used during daylight hours and not used at times of seriously reduced visibility (3 times)
- Front Tyre not fitted in accordance with side wall instruction/s (4.1.2e) (2 times)
- this is a daytime test only (1 times)
- no lights fitted at time of test (1 times)
- vehicle was issued with a daytime mot (1 times)
- THIS VEHICLE IS FOR DAY LIGHT USE ONLY (1 times)
- Centre no lights fitted at time of test. Day light use only. (1 times)
- Day time MOT (1 times)
- Horn is not a constant note (1.7.3c) (1 times)
- Offside Front shock absorber seal failed and leaking oil (2.3.3) (1 times)
- Registration plate not fixed vertically, or as close to vertical as is reasonably practical (6.3.2b) (1 times)
- deep cut to side wall (1 times)
- Rear Wheel alignment incorrect which adversely affects the handling (2.5.1) (1 times)
